INVASIVE SPECIES MANAGEMENT is a federal award for W2sd Endist New York held by First Environment Inc. Estimated value $150K ($150K obligated). Current period of performance ends Feb 20, 2027. Place of performance: BUTLER NJ. Related solicitation W912DS22R0005.
